#459805 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#459805 is composed of 27.1% red, 59.6% green and 2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 54.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 96.7% yellow and 40.4% black. It has a hue angle of 93.9 degrees, a saturation of 93.6% and a lightness of 30.8%. #459805 color hex could be obtained by blending #8aff0a with #003100. Closest websafe color is: #339900.

#459805 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#459805 has RGB values of R:69, G:152, B:5 and CMYK values of C:0.55, M:0, Y:0.97, K:0.4. Its decimal value is 4560901.
